INTRODUCTION
My goal:• Share my LESSONS LEARNED for all alterations
• Assist to expedite alterations
What is an Alteration?
– Any action by any entity other than USACE that builds
upon, alters, improves, moves, obstructs, or occupies an
existing USACE project.
-Includes Section 408s and Letters of No Objection (LNO)

SECTION 408 VS LNO
Maintenance, Operations, and Repair activities conducted
by the levee sponsor does not fall under Section 408
permission but generally will require coordination and
concurrence from USACE.

REQUEST FORMS – INSTRUCTIONS16
Common Mistakes
-Requester Information - provide the name of the entity,
organization or company requesting the alteration. The
engineering design firm is not the Requester.
-Alteration Description – do not write “see attached”
-Alteration Description – provide a description of the
proposed alteration and reference the existing levee
stationing and GPS coordinates
-Local Sponsor Signature - Be sure to have the levee
sponsor approve and sign-off
-Requester Signature – This is not the design firm.

MEMORANDUM OF AGREEMENTS (MOA)
What is a memorandum of agreement (MOA)?
– An authority which allows USACE to accept and expend funds to expedite the review and evaluation of a Section 408 request.
– MOAs do not apply to low-impact alterations or LNOs
– Alterations which require a Pre-Coordination Meeting are likely candidates for MOA
– The District Levee Safety Officer (LSO) will determine if an Section 408 meets requirements for an MOA.

MEMORANDUM OF AGREEMENTS (MOA)
– Contributed funds pay for USACE efforts for the following: Plan, Specs, Calculation Review
Environmental Review
Review of Real Estate Documents
Construction Oversight
As-built Review
O&M Manuals Updates

REGULATORY COORDINATION
You may need to obtain USACE Regulatory Program
permission:
– Section 10 of the Rivers and Harbors Act of 1899
– Section 404 of the Clean Water Act
– Is your project located near or in:• Below Ordinary High Water?
• Wetlands?
• Swamps?
• Rivers or Lakes?

REAL ESTATE
Any alteration within levee right-of-way shall have
subordinate rights to the Operation and Maintenance of
the Levee System.
For alterations, USACE may require a Real Estate
agreement (as per EC 1165-2-220) for an
encroachment.
37
![Page 38: ALTERATIONS SECTION 408 AND LNOs - United States Army](https://reader033.fdocuments.net/reader033/viewer/2022053104/62918d9e51a36155ea3204dc/html5/thumbnails/38.jpg)
REAL ESTATE
Per LRL-803, any alteration located within levee right-of-
way may be damaged, removed or destroyed by the
local sponsor during a flood emergency. And…
The local sponsor is not liable for such damage or
destruction.
This includes unauthorized encroachments.

CHANGES IN THE APPROVED ALTERATION
Changes in the approved alteration will need additional
evaluation by USACE to determine if it still meets USACE
design guidelines.
STOP WORK and contact the LSAR and Section 408
coordinator ASAP.

WHAT TO LOOK FOR...48
SECTION 408 ENVIRONMENTAL ASSESSMENTS
-As per the new Section 408 guidance (EC 1165-2-220),
alterations will require an Environmental Assessment (EA).
-This would mean every alteration would need SHPO and
an Endangered Species Act review (and maybe additional
environmental reviews in order to obtain USACE approval).
-LRL is currently working on a Programmatic EA which will
include the majority of all low-impact alterations. This
means low-impact alterations would be exempt from further
in-depth environmental evaluations.
